I think that the rules about trans people competing should be adjusted specifically to each and every discipline. There are plenty of different factors that may affect the performance. And I dare to say, that in some events, ftm people could have some kind of advantage too.
Still, there is so little trans participants, that organisations just don't care about making those rules. It seems like IOC made that very vague overall rule sticked to only one factor (testosterone) without any further insight. I suppose they may thought that it won't be an issue in the next 15-20 years.
And right now it seems like Hubbard and other trans people fall atls the victims of the situation with all the hatred towards them. I feel kinda sorry for her.

dodge got a reaction from Oldira in Men's Rugby Sevens WR Final Olympic Games Qualification Tournament 2021
For those who don’t know the IRFU (Irish rugby federation) abandoned sevens for years. They put zero money into it and would not allow any of the professional players (those who play for the 4 provincial/professional teams) to play for the sevens team. In the top 2 tiers of international rugby, Ireland was the only one not to compete at the world sevens level
So for this group of players, many of whom have been on the sevens team for years, to overcome that is huge.
